In this episode of The Private Equity Podcast, Alex Rawlings speaks with Paul Golden, an experienced CEO, private equity investor, and operating partner with nine private equity-backed exits and more than 20 add-on acquisitions.

Paul shares lessons from operating, investing, and leading PE-backed businesses, including why speed matters when building the right leadership team, how to identify strong executives, and what separates successful acquisitions from deals that destroy value.

The conversation explores the danger of “deal fever,” the importance of knowing when to walk away from an acquisition, and why delighted customers, strong management teams, and clear growth pathways are critical indicators of a quality investment.

Paul also explains the challenges of changing deeply embedded founder-led cultures, how to approach add-on acquisition integration, and the practical actions that helped generate more than $150 million in free cash flow in one manufacturing business.

Finally, Paul discusses why PE-backed executives need the confidence to make mistakes, take ownership, and communicate openly with their boards.

Key Highlights

00:00 – Paul Golden’s Background
From senior public-company leadership to private equity investing, operating partner roles, CEO positions, and nine PE-backed exits.

01:29 – The Biggest PE Leadership Mistake
Why private equity firms need to make faster decisions about whether the right management team is in place.

03:21 – Identifying the Right Executives
The importance of leaders who are confident enough to be challenged by their teams and boards.

04:44 – What Paul Looks for in Executive Interviews
Why candidates who openly discuss mistakes, take responsibility, and explain what they learned often make stronger leaders.

07:05 – The Hardest CEO Decisions
Why firing customers or exiting customer segments can sometimes be harder than changing the management team.

08:28 – What Drives Successful PE Exits
Delighted customers, strong management, and clear opportunities for growth.

11:14 – Lessons From Exit One to Exit Nine
Avoiding deal fever, strengthening diligence, and making critical decisions faster during the first 18–24 months.

14:26 – Changing Founder-Led Cultures
The challenges of accelerating decision-making in businesses shaped by the same founder for decades.

17:28 – Who Stays and Who Goes Post-Acquisition
How to identify advocates for change, potential resistors, and leadership team members who can adapt.

20:55 – Lessons From 20+ Add-On Acquisitions
Why cultural fit becomes increasingly important as the size of an add-on grows.

24:41 – Generating $150M+ in Free Cash Flow
Using lean principles, customer value, SKU rationalisation, inventory reduction, and process improvement to unlock cash.

29:56 – The Essential Skill for PE-Backed CXOs
Having the confidence to make decisions, admit mistakes, own the outcome, and explain what comes next.

31:53 – Leadership Frameworks That Shaped Paul
Lean Thinking, the Danaher Business System, Good to Great, and Michael Porter’s Five Forces.
